Abstract
The invention discloses a kind of security against fire locks, including lock housing, locking bar, sled mechanism, pin plate mechanism and unlock plectrum, sled mechanism is slidably mounted on lock housing, pin plate mechanism slips are installed on locking bar, pin plate mechanism and sled mechanism lean cooperation, locking bar is equipped with the step for the cooperation that leans with sled mechanism, and unlock plectrum is used to stir sled mechanism.The security against fire door lock of the present invention is using sled mechanism, pin plate mechanism and unlock plectrum so that the safety of security against fire lock increases;Using knob and safe driving lever, without key unlocking in shutter door, security against fire is effectively ensured;Using the first lock core and the second lock core so that this door lock needs two keys that could open outdoors, improves the safety of door lock.

Technical field
The present invention relates to lockset, more particularly to a kind of security against fire lock.
Background technology
Inside and outside open of existing shutter door lock is required for key, when there is fire when the accident generation of threat to life safety,
People in shutter door also wants finding key, it is difficult to escape within first time.Usually only there are one open tool existing shutter door lock
Lock key, user only need a key that can open shutter door lock, poor safety performance.
Invention content
One of the object of the present invention is to provide a kind of security against fire lock, can at least solve the above problems.
To achieve the above object, according to an aspect of the invention, there is provided a kind of security against fire is locked, including lock housing, lock
Bar, sled mechanism, pin plate mechanism and unlock plectrum, sled mechanism are slidably mounted on lock housing, and pin plate mechanism slips are installed on locking bar,
Pin plate mechanism and sled mechanism lean cooperation, and locking bar is equipped with the step for the cooperation that leans with sled mechanism, unlocks plectrum and be used for
Stir sled mechanism.The setting of sled mechanism, pin plate mechanism and unlock plectrum causes security against fire lock to increase safe guarantor as a result,
Hinder mechanism.Plectrum is unlocked by shake-up during unlocking, pin plate mechanism resists sled mechanism, sled mechanism is made to get out of the way locking bar passage,
It can unlock, lockset safety has been effectively ensured.

Specific embodiment
The invention will now be described in further detail with reference to the accompanying drawings.
Fig. 1~5 schematically show a kind of security against fire lock of embodiment according to the present invention.
As depicted in figs. 1 and 2, which locks, including lock housing 1, locking bar 2, sled mechanism 3, pin plate mechanism 4 and unlock
Plectrum 5, sled mechanism 3 are slidably mounted on lock housing 1, and pin plate mechanism 4 is slidably mounted on locking bar 2, pin plate mechanism 4 and sled mechanism 3
Lean cooperation, and locking bar 2 is equipped with the step 21 for the cooperation that leans with sled mechanism 3, and unlock plectrum 5 is used to stir sled mechanism 3.
Locking bar 2 is two, and two locking bars 2 are equipped with the step 21 for the cooperation that leans with sled mechanism 3, and pin plate mechanism 4 is slidably mounted on
One of two locking bars 2.
Sled mechanism 3 includes slide plate 31 and skateboard spring 32.The end of slide plate 31 is equipped with baffle 33 and shifting block 34, slide plate
31st, baffle 33 and shifting block 34 are an integral molding structure.The step 21 of baffle 33 and locking bar 2 leans cooperation, and shifting block 34 is with unlocking
Plectrum 5 matches.Skateboard spring 32 is torsional spring.One end of skateboard spring 32 is installed on lock housing 1, and the other end is connected with slide plate 31.
When unlock plectrum 5, which stirs shifting block 34, lifts slide plate 31, baffle 33 and the step 21 of locking bar 2 are detached from, and locking bar 2 is removable.When
When slide plate 31 is fallen, baffle 33 and the step 21 of locking bar 2 offset, and limit the movement of locking bar 2.
Lock housing 1 is mounted by means of screws with installing plate 11.Installing plate 11 is equipped with the first locating rod 12, the first locating rod 12
For screw.Slide plate 31 is provided with the first sliding groove 35, and the first locating rod 12 is located in the first sliding groove 35.
Pin plate mechanism 4 includes pin plate 41 and pin plate spring 42.Pin plate 41 is equipped with plug 43, and plug 43 can be inserted into 31 bottom of slide plate
Between end and lock housing 1.Pin plate 41 and plug 43 are an integral molding structure.Pin plate spring 42 is torsional spring.One end of pin plate spring 42
Locking bar 2 is installed on, the other end is connected with pin plate 41.When slide plate 31 lifts, plug 43 be inserted into 31 bottom end of slide plate and lock housing 1 it
Between, locking bar 2 is removable.Plug 43 is exited between 31 bottom end of slide plate and lock housing 1, and slide plate 31 is fallen, and limits the movement of locking bar 2.
Locking bar 2 is equipped with the second locating rod 23, and the second locating rod 23 is screw.Pin plate 41 is provided with second sliding slot 44, and second is fixed
Position bar 23 is located in second sliding slot 44.
As shown in figure 3, the outside of lock housing 1 is equipped with knob 13 and safe driving lever 14.Knob 13 is sequentially connected with locking bar 2, rotation
Button 13 can drive locking bar 2 to move, and locking bar 2 is made to complete unlocking and locking action.Safe driving lever 14 connects with the unlock transmission of plectrum 5
It connects.Safe driving lever 14 is stirred, can swing unlock plectrum 5, so as to complete operation of the unlock plectrum 5 to sled mechanism 3.
Locking bar 2, knob 13, the first lock core 7 of the fire-fighting door lock of present embodiment are sequentially connected with transmission gear.Transmission
Gear is as shown in dotted line in Fig. 1 and Fig. 2.Lock housing 1 is also provided with locking button 15, and button 15 is locked in rotation, makes the first lock core 7 and transmission
Gear is detached from, and the first lock core 7 is ineffective, and key can not then open lockset outdoors, play safety effect.
As shown in Figure 4 and Figure 5, the security against fire lock of present embodiment further includes locking closure 6, the first lock core 7 and the second lock core
8, the first lock core 7 and the second lock core 8 are mounted on locking closure 6.First lock core 7 is sequentially connected with locking bar 2, the second lock core 8 and unlock
Plectrum 5 matches.Second lock core 8 is provided with cam 81, and unlock plectrum 5 is L-shaped piece, and cam 81 coordinates with L-shaped piece, it can be achieved that solving
Lock the swing of plectrum 5.
The unlocking of the security against fire lock of present embodiment and locking process are:
Fig. 1 is the locking state of security against fire lock.Shutter door is locked at this point, locking bar 2 stretches out, slide plate 31 is in and falls shape
State, step 21 and the baffle 33 of locking bar 2 offset, and limitation locking bar 2 moves, and 13 or first lock core 7 of knob can not move locking bar 2.
Fig. 2 is the unlocking condition of security against fire lock.Safe 14 or second lock core 8 of driving lever swings unlock plectrum 5, and unlock is dialled
Piece 5 offsets with shifting block 34, stirs slide plate 31, and slide plate 31 lifts, and gap occurs between 31 bottom end of slide plate and the bottom surface of lock housing 1, pin
Plate 41 is mobile under the action of pin plate spring 42 to make plug 43 be inserted between 31 bottom end of slide plate and the bottom surface of lock housing 1 so that slide plate
31 in lifting state.Due to lifting for slide plate 31, baffle 33 allows open position for the step 21 of locking bar 2, passes through knob 13 or the
One lock core 7 moves locking bar 2.
When 13 or first lock core 7 of knob moves locking bar 2, pin plate 41 is moved with locking bar 2, and plug 43 is from 31 bottom end of slide plate
It is extracted out between the bottom surface of lock housing 1, slide plate 31 is automatically fallen off under the action of skateboard spring 32, therefore, is also needed when unlocking again
Pull unlock driving lever 5.
Therefore, the security against fire lock of present embodiment needs two keys, but when locking outdoors when unlocking outdoors, only
Need a key.
